Ikeja Oba-elect Dies after Six Years without Installation
The 65-year-old monarch-in-waiting, who had been clamouring to be installed for close to six years, reportedly died last Monday after a brief illness, and had been buried according to Muslim rites.
The association’s official, who craved anonymity owing to the sensitivity of the issue, said members of the group were currently meeting with a view to communicating the death of Adeleye to the Lagos State Government officially. Adeleye was nominated Oba-elect of Ikeja in December 2014, following the death of the then monarch, Oba Maruf Amore.
Only recently, the late Adeleye had spoken to THISDAY, during which he appealed to the state Governor, Babajide Sanwo-Olu, to coronate him, after having to wait for close to six years.
